A woman has been charged criminally for making a phone call that falsely reported a bomb in Tallahassee. The call was made by 33-year-old Paulletta Higgins to the Florida Department of Children and Families. Higgins called the office nearly 100 times after she was refused food assistance by the office. She then told a person who answered the phone that a bomb was going to go off. The building was not evacuated and Higgins is charged with falsely reporting a bomb, making harassing phone calls and falsely reporting a crime.
